Bulgarian Parliament is preparing to override veto and continue the supply of armored vehicles to Ukraine, - Prime Minister

Bulgarian Prime Minister Nikolai Denkov is confident that the majority in parliament will reject the veto imposed by President Rumen Radev on the agreement to supply armored vehicles to Ukraine. This was reported by Novinite.


"This veto (on the transfer of armored vehicles to Ukraine - ed.) will be overcome, so I don't see what to comment on," Denkov said.


Earlier we reported that Bulgarian President Rumen Radev vetoed the already ratified agreement on the free supply of 100 armored personnel carriers to Ukraine, local media reported.
